
Cost of Terrace Construction in Joplin
Constructing a terrace in Joplin, MO can be a valuable addition to your home, providing a beautiful outdoor space for relaxation and entertainment. However, understanding the costs involved is crucial for effective planning and budgeting. Various factors influence the overall cost of terrace construction, and knowing these can help you make informed decisions.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Choice: The type of materials used, such as wood, composite, or concrete, can significantly impact the overall cost.
- Size and Design: Larger terraces with intricate designs or multi-level structures will generally cost more.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Joplin, MO can vary, affecting the total expenditure.
- Permits and Regulations: Obtaining necessary permits and adhering to local building codes may add to the cost.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the construction site, including grading and clearing, can influence expenses.
- Additional Features: Incorporating elements such as lighting, railings, or built-in seating can increase costs.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ather variations in Joplin, MO may affect construction timelines and costs.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(in Joplin, MO) |
---|---|
Basic Wood Deck Installation | $15 - $30 per square foot |
Composite Deck Installation | $25 - $45 per square foot |
Concrete Patio Construction | $10 - $20 per square foot |
Site Preparation | $500 - $1,500 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
Railings Installation | $20 - $60 per linear foot |
Built-in Seating | $500 - $2,000 |
Lighting Installation | $200 - $1,000 |
